Subject:paths to ptviewer.jar and source.jpg files not working

Thread:


proj-imim: paths to ptviewer.jar and source.jpg files not working Caroling 2000-May-17 22:29:15
I can't get archive to work with ptviewer.jar. I have a
complex website and would like to have one copy of
ptviewer.jar, but call it from several parts of my site.
According to my tests, archive looks in the same directory
or any directory under that branch from the top. But it
won't look at the top from any branch. 

If I have /movies/allAround/ptviewer.jar, 
I can write in /movies/file1.html, archive=allAround/ptviewer.jar
But I can not write in /Trips/movies/file2.html, archive=../../movies/allAround/ptviewer.jar
Even if I move ptviewer.jar to the top, 
I can not write in /Trips/movies/file2.html, archive=../../ptviewer.jar

Does this mean there is no relative addressing? I haven't
tried to hard code the URL because that is just about
unacceptable. I would have to have two versions of each
file. One to test on my desktop and one to upload to the
server. 

Also, it looks like the same limitation exists for the
source image file. What I need is to have the page.html, the
ptviewer.jar and the image.jpg all be in different parts of
the site. How is this possible?

If I did the tests right, this means that I must use many
copies of the applet and many duplicates of graphics and a
nightmare to maintain. I'm not using anything like
Dreamweaver that might make it easier, I don't know.
